Dr. Ariana Candaras ND
About Dr. Ariana Candaras ND
Naturopath
Ariana runs a general practice, and welcomes anyone looking to make positive changes to their health and wellbeing, from young children to older adults. She takes a special interest in mental health, stress management, hormonal imbalance, digestive issues and skin conditions. Specific conditions include, but are not limited to:
- Anxiety, Depression, mood disorders
- Acne, eczema, psoriasis, rashes and hives
- Menstrual concerns, from menarche to menopause
- Gas, bloating, food intolerances, IBS and IBD
- Pediatric care
Ariana strives to make better health attainable, simple, and sustainable for all patients who walk through her door. She advocates for maintaining a balanced lifestyle and making health a priority in order to bring focus back to living a more enjoyable and meaningful life.
Naturopathic medicine is a philosophy. Ariana practices it herself through maintaining an active, social and environmentally conscious lifestyle. She wants her patients to wholly thrive with what naturopathic medicine has to offer.

Qualifications
Dr. Ariana obtained her Doctor of Naturopathy degree from the Canadian College of Naturopathic Medicine (CCNM) in Toronto. During her fourth year, she completed her clinical internship at the Robert Schad Naturopathic Clinic and the Brampton Naturopathic Teaching Clinic. Dr. Ariana continues her education with special interests in pediatrics, natural pregnancy and birth, herbal medicine and Traditional Chinese medicine.
Dr. Ariana is a professional member in good standing with the Canadian Association of Naturopathic Doctors (CAND), the Ontario Association of Naturopathic Doctors (OAND) and a practicing member of the College of the College of Naturopathic Doctors of Ontario (CONO).
